Talent Acquisition Specialist
The ideal candidate will have prior experience in recruitment or human resources, with solid knowledge of searching, screening, interviewing, and hiring practices.
Responsibilities
1. Recruitment & On-boarding
• Develop effective recruiting plans and strategies
• Manage the full recruiting lifecycle across a variety of open roles; helping management find, hire, and retain quality talent
• Work closely with hiring managers to gain a comprehensive understanding of the company's hiring needs for each position and meet competitive hiring goals & expectations. Review and clarify job specifications, competencies and skills required
• Utilize knowledge of multiple recruiting sources and execute innovative recruiting strategies to find quality candidates and prospect for new business
• Screen resumes and prospects, qualify, interview, and manage candidates throughout interview process
• Conduct background checks, facilitate pre-employment testing and assisting with final offer negotiation
• Process on boarding, closely coordinate with respective department for start date and request tools need by new hire, I.D issuance, registering to biometric, making of Job Order and sending to Compensation & Benefits team
• Ensure organized maintenance of 201 records, ensure all requirements and other employee documents are maintained in their 201 file in a secure filing cabinets
2. Controlling
• Update and close monitoring headcount plan and approved budget
• Update records in internal database, close monitor all hiring status
• Maintain a database of candidate records, including active and passive prospects
• Monitor employees list under probation and send reminder to immediate head for performance evaluation, issue and follow PAN according to the result
• Close coordination with manpower agencies for ensure all hiring requirements are meet
• Keep and monitor manpower agency contracts for renewal, review rates and ensure prompt communication with manpower agency regarding violations committed by the manpower they have provided.
• Update head count and staff details per branch in HRIS.
3. Off-boarding
• Process off boarding of employee, make clearance of employee and route for signature and ensure no pending clearances
• Provide exit interview form to resigned employee and endorse report to HR Head
Skills and Qualifications
• 5+ years' experience in recruitment or human resources
• Exceptional communication, interpersonal, and decision-making skills
• Advanced knowledge of MS Office, database management, and internet search
• Familiarity with job boards, and HR software, databases, and management system
• Proven experience conducting various types of interviews (i.e., phone, video, etc.)
